Definition of 'Discount Rate'

The discount rate is a term used in finance to describe the interest rate that a lender charges a borrower for a loan. The discount rate is also used by central banks to set the monetary policy of a country.

The discount rate is important because it affects the cost of borrowing money and the level of economic activity. When the discount rate is low, it makes it cheaper for businesses and individuals to borrow money, which can lead to increased investment and economic growth. However, when the discount rate is high, it makes it more expensive to borrow money, which can lead to decreased investment and economic growth.

The discount rate is set by the central bank of a country. The central bank uses the discount rate to control the money supply and interest rates in the economy. By raising or lowering the discount rate, the central bank can influence the cost of borrowing money and the level of economic activity.

Here are some additional details about the discount rate:

* The discount rate is typically set by the central bank's monetary policy committee.
* The discount rate is used to set the interest rate on central bank loans to commercial banks.
